摘 要:目的探讨解剖型桡骨远端掌侧锁定接骨板内固定治疗老年陈旧性桡骨远端骨折的手术复位固定技巧并评价其疗效。方法 2014年10月—2015年9月,采用解剖型桡骨远端掌侧锁定接骨板治疗25例老年陈旧性桡骨远端骨折。其中男3例,女22例;年龄65~87岁,平均73岁。致伤原因:摔伤19例,交通事故伤6例。均为闭合性骨折,按AO分型:A2型10例,A3型7例,B3型3例,C1型5例。其中18例因骨折不稳定行手法复位石膏固定,之后复位丢失行手术治疗;7例未接受任何治疗。病程33~126 d,平均61 d。术前掌倾角(–16.0±3.1)°,尺偏角(10.8±7.0)°,桡骨短缩(11.2±3.6)mm,腕关节屈曲活动度(41.0±7.5)°,腕关节背伸活动度(42.0±6.3)°,握力为健侧的33.0%±3.1%。结果术后患者切口均Ⅰ期愈合,无术后早期并发症发生。25例患者均获随访,随访时间1~1.5年,平均1.3年。X线片复查示所有患者骨折均顺利愈合,愈合时间为8~12周,平均9.2周;关节面移位均<1 mm。末次随访时桡骨远端掌倾角为(13.1±3.2)°,尺偏角为(21.9±4.6)°,桡骨短缩(2.0±1.1)mm,腕关节屈曲活动度为(52.0±11.7)°,腕关节背伸活动度为(65.0±4.8)°,握力为健侧的84.0%±4.2%,均较术前显著改善(P<0.05)。末次随访时采用Gartland和Werley评分评价疗效,优15例,良6例,可2例,差2例,优良率84%。结论利用解剖型桡骨远端掌侧锁定接骨板设计上的优势,辅以适当的手术技巧,能较好地复位固定老年陈旧性桡骨远端骨折,取得满意疗效。Objective To investigate the surgical technique and effectiveness ofvolar locking plates for senile delayed distal radius fractures. Methods Between October 2014 and September 2015, 25 cases of delayed distal radius fractures were treated by volar locking plates. There were 3 males and 22 females with an average age of 73 years (range, 65-87 years). Injury was caused by tumble in 19 cases and by traffic accident in 6 cases. All the cases had closed fracture. According to the AO classification, 10 cases were rated as type A2, 7 cases as type A3, 3 cases as type B3, and 5 cases as type C1. The manual reduction and plaster immobilization were performed in 18 cases first, but reduction failed; no treatment was given in 7 cases before surgery. The time from injury to surgery was from 33 to 126 days (mean, 61 days). Preoperatively, the volar tilting angle was (16.0±3.1)% the ulnar inclining angle was (10.8±7.0)°; the radial shortening was (11.2±3.6) ram; the wrist range of motion was (41.0±7.5)° in flexion and was (42.0±6.3)° in extension; and the grip strength was 33.0%±3.1% of normal side. Results All incisions healed primarily, and no postoperative complication occurred. The patients were followed up 1-1.5 years (mean, 1.3 years). The X-ray films showed that fracture union was achieved in all the patients, with the mean healing time of 9.2 weeks (range, 8-12 weeks); the displacement of the articular surface was less than 1 ram. At last follow-up, the volar tilting angle was (13.1±3.2)°; the ulnar inclining angle was (21.9±4.6)°; the radial shortening was (2.0± 1.1) mm; the wrist range of motion was (52.0± 11.7)°in flexion and was (65.0±4.8)° in extension; and the grip strength was 84.0%±4.2% of normal side; all showed significant difference when compared with preoperative ones (P〈0.05).
